Pentagon Seals Multiple Interior Sections After Air-Quality Alert

Hazmat teams supported by Arlington County are testing an unidentified contaminant as personnel shelter in place.

Overview

  • Building environmental systems flagged an air-quality problem, prompting Pentagon security to activate standard protection protocols.
  • Multiple interior areas were closed off, with unnamed sources saying floors two through five in corridors four through seven were sealed.
  • Security staff inside the building were observed wearing gas masks and full chemical-protective gear during the response.
  • A hazardous-materials team deployed to the scene is conducting tests and Arlington County Fire and Rescue is providing support.
  • An internal Pentagon message said additional testing could take one to two hours and officials have not yet identified the substance so the situation remains under active assessment.
